Output 89ddebae384da69bbb6ca471c8d2b505c00bc1bfd042f9f185cd86a0ef4bcbe9:1

value
90657956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6dfd7f1cd6edf22539aa66088a4adfc94793fba OP_EQUAL
address
3JMy4NtgdQY3cdvayqTonvKr1c3YQ8H9cw
transaction
89ddebae384da69bbb6ca471c8d2b505c00bc1bfd042f9f185cd86a0ef4bcbe9
confirmations
379131
spent
true